Former Globetrotter Joins Suwanee Sports Academy

James Hodges formerly of the Harlem Globetrotters joins Suwanee Sports Academy. Hodges will be a player development instructor for the Academy's On Court Player Development program.

SUWANEE, GA (PRWEB) June 3, 2005 -- James Hodges, former member of the Harlem Globetrotters, announced this week that he will join the Suwanee Sports Academy (SSA) as a Player Development Instructor. James will be part of the coaching staff of the Academys new program On Court Player Development, which offers comprehensive basketball development for kids beginning in kindergarten and continuing all the way thru the pros. James played professional basketball for 11 years in various leagues around the world. He has spent the last several years with the World Basketball Association as the Director of Scouting.

James brings a passion for the game of basketball and a wealth of knowledge to our On Court Player Development program. I have seen James work with kids, and he really understands how to connect with them and help them improve," notes Kevin Cantwell, Director of Basketball Programs at SSA.

Along with his duties as a coach, James will help develop SSAs training program for elite and professional basketball players. Already SSA is planning to train at least a dozen NBA and other professional basketball players this summer as they prepare for their upcoming seasons. I look forward to working with James and the rest of the staff at the Suwanee Sports Academy this summer," said the Phoenix Suns Amare Stoudemire.

About Suwanee Sports Academy
The Suwanee Sports Academy (SSA), located just outside Atlanta, is the largest privately owned facility in the country for basketball and volleyball training and competitive events. The facility is 100,000 square feet and includes seven NBA regulation basketball courts and nine volleyball courts. Offerings include a variety of training programs, leagues, tournaments and camps.
